How Does Prolonged Storage Affect Consumer Products?
Various environmental conditions can cause
Degradation of materials Exposure to heat, cold, or humidity may lead to material breakdown, compromising product integrity.
Changes in chemical composition Storage conditions can alter the chemical makeup of your products, affecting performance and safety.
Physical transformations Prolonged storage may cause changes in shape, size, or texture, impacting product usability.
Common Challenges Faced by Manufacturers
When storing consumer goods in hot, cold, or humid environments, manufacturers often encounter
Temperature-induced degradation Extreme temperatures can accelerate material breakdown.
Humidity-related issues High humidity levels can lead to water absorption, affecting product performance and stability.
Inadequate storage facilities Insufficient or poorly maintained storage areas can exacerbate existing problems.
